Must-Try Foods at Hong Kong Night Markets
Explore the must-try foods that define the Hong Kong night market experience. Get ready for a culinary adventure! Hong Kong's night markets are a paradise for food lovers, offering a wide array of delectable treats that will tantalize your taste buds. From savory snacks to sweet desserts, there's something to satisfy every craving. One of the most iconic dishes is curry fish balls, a street food staple that's both spicy and flavorful. These bite-sized balls of fish are simmered in a rich curry sauce and served on a stick, making them the perfect on-the-go snack. Another must-try is stinky tofu, a fermented tofu dish with a pungent aroma that's surprisingly addictive. Don't let the smell deter you; the taste is a delightful combination of savory and umami. For those with a sweet tooth, egg waffles are a must. These crispy, golden waffles are made with a sweet batter and cooked in a special mold, creating a unique texture that's both chewy and crunchy. And of course, no visit to a Hong Kong night market is complete without trying dim sum. These bite-sized dumplings and buns are filled with a variety of savory and sweet fillings, and they're best enjoyed with a cup of hot tea. These are just a few of the many culinary delights that await you at Hong Kong's night markets. So, come hungry and be prepared to indulge in a food lover's paradise! You'll also find variations of these classics, such as fish balls in different sauces like satay or mala, offering a diverse range of flavors to explore. Stinky tofu also comes in grilled or deep-fried versions, each providing a unique textural experience. Egg waffles can be customized with various toppings, from ice cream and fruit to chocolate sauce and sprinkles, making them a highly personalized treat. And the world of dim sum is vast and varied, with countless types of dumplings, buns, and rolls to discover, each with its own distinct flavor profile and preparation method. Beyond these well-known dishes, the night markets also feature seasonal specialties and regional delicacies, ensuring that there's always something new and exciting to try. Keep an eye out for unique offerings like grilled squid, spicy wontons, and herbal teas, which provide a glimpse into the diverse culinary landscape of Hong Kong. With so much to choose from, navigating the food stalls can be an overwhelming but ultimately rewarding experience, as you sample your way through the best of Hong Kong's street food culture. Don't be afraid to try something new or ask the vendors for recommendations; they're often happy to share their knowledge and passion for their food.
Top Night Markets to Explore
Exploring the top night markets will enhance your Hong Kong experience. Hong Kong boasts several vibrant night markets, each offering a unique atmosphere and a diverse array of food and goods. Temple Street Night Market is perhaps the most famous, known for its fortune tellers, opera singers, and, of course, its delicious street food. Here, you can find everything from seafood and noodles to traditional snacks and desserts. Ladies' Market in Mong Kok is another popular destination, offering a wide selection of clothing, accessories, and souvenirs, as well as a variety of street food stalls. This market is particularly lively and bustling, with vendors hawking their wares and shoppers haggling for the best prices. For a more local experience, head to Sham Shui Po Night Market, where you'll find a mix of food stalls, clothing vendors, and electronics shops. This market is less touristy than Temple Street and Ladies' Market, offering a glimpse into the everyday life of Hong Kong residents. Each market has its unique charm and appeal, and each offers a distinct experience. Temple Street Night Market is a great place to experience the traditional side of Hong Kong, with its fortune tellers and opera singers adding to the cultural ambiance. Ladies' Market is perfect for bargain hunters, with its wide selection of affordable clothing and accessories. Sham Shui Po Night Market is a great place to get a sense of the local culture, with its mix of food, clothing, and electronics vendors. Tips for a Successful Night Market Food Tour
Plan for a successful night market food tour with these essential tips. Navigating Hong Kong's night markets can be an exciting but sometimes overwhelming experience. To make the most of your food tour, it's essential to come prepared. First and foremost, wear comfortable shoes. You'll be doing a lot of walking, so you'll want to make sure your feet are happy. Next, bring cash. While some vendors may accept credit cards, many prefer cash, especially for smaller purchases. It's also a good idea to bring small denominations, as it can be difficult to get change for larger bills. Another tip is to go early. The night markets tend to get crowded later in the evening, so arriving early will give you more space to browse and sample the food. And speaking of food, don't be afraid to try new things! Hong Kong's night markets offer a wide variety of culinary delights, so be adventurous and sample as many different dishes as you can. Be sure to stay hydrated. It can get hot and humid in Hong Kong, so it's important to drink plenty of water. You can purchase bottled water at the markets, or you can bring your own. Also, be mindful of your belongings. The night markets can be crowded, so it's important to keep an eye on your wallet, phone, and other valuables. Consider using a crossbody bag or a money belt to keep your belongings safe. Finally, be respectful of the vendors and the local culture. The night markets are a vital part of Hong Kong's heritage, so it's important to treat them with respect. Be polite, don't haggle too aggressively, and be mindful of your noise level. By following these tips, you can have a safe, enjoyable, and delicious night market food tour in Hong Kong.
